How Initial Evaluations Help You Address Water Damage

When a property sustains water damage, carrying out an initial assessment is vital for proper restoration. This process involves identifying the source of the water intrusion, assessing the extent of the damage, and identifying the areas that have been affected. A comprehensive assessment allows restoration professionals to classify the water—whether clean, gray, or black—directing the appropriate response measures.

Additionally, the assessment helps in recognizing potential hazards, such as structural instability or mold growth, which can hinder restoration efforts. By recording the results, specialists can formulate a customized restoration blueprint that addresses the most important areas first. This systematic approach not only limits further deterioration but also optimizes resource utilization. At the core, an precise initial inspection lays the foundation for a successful recovery effort, guaranteeing that every required measure is implemented to return the property to its original state effectively and efficiently.

What Comes After Water Extraction: Effective Drying Solutions?

After water extraction, the next significant step in the restoration process involves implementing effective drying solutions. This stage is crucial to avoiding additional damage and ensuring a successful restoration. Professionals utilize industrial-grade dehumidifiers and air movers to reduce moisture levels in the affected areas. Dehumidifiers extract excess humidity from the air, while air movers circulate air to expedite the drying process.

Tracking moisture content is critical during this phase. Specialists commonly employ hygrometers to guarantee all materials, including walls and floors, attain proper dryness levels. According to the level of the water-related damage, specialized tools like thermal cameras may be employed to detect hidden moisture pockets.

Furthermore, adequate ventilation is essential; opening windows and using exhaust fans can enhance airflow. In summary, a systematic drying process ensures the structural integrity is maintained and reduces the likelihood of secondary problems like mold development.

How to Keep Future Water Damage at Bay

Preventing future water damage requires routine maintenance and forward-thinking strategies. Property owners should regularly examine their home for signs of leaks, paying close attention to roofs, gutters, and plumbing fixtures. Tackling small problems early can stop more serious issues from developing over time.

Implementing sump pump systems and servicing drainage systems can help divert excess water away from the home's foundation. Moreover, establishing proper grading around the home will reduce water accumulation near the property.

Regularly cleaning gutters and downspouts is critical for proper water management. Furthermore, incorporating moisture-resistant materials for basement and crawl space areas can lower the potential for water damage.

Finally, measuring indoor humidity levels can stop mold growth, which frequently follows water damage. By adopting these strategies, property owners can greatly reduce the likelihood of future water damage problems, preserving their property and protecting their investment for years to come.

What Are the Warning Signs of Hidden Water Damage?

Signs of hidden water damage include musty odors, unexplained mold growth, water stains on walls or ceilings, warped floors, and rising humidity levels. Timely detection is vital to preventing greater structural harm and potential health concerns.

Am I Able to Perform Water Damage Restoration Myself?

Although some minor water damage repairs can be handled independently, serious damage usually necessitates expert intervention. DIY efforts may overlook underlying problems, possibly causing more extensive harm and greater financial burden down the road.

What Should I Do Immediately After a Water Leak?

Right after a water leak is detected, it is important to shut off the water supply, disconnect all electrical equipment, and remove excess water. After that, ensuring the area is fully dried and inspecting for damage are essential for preventing further issues.
